The field of candidates seeking to become Vermont's next governor is growing.
Lt. Gov. Phil Scott told WPTZ-TV that he plans to send an email to supporters on Tuesday announcing his campaign for the Republican gubernatorial nomination, with a traditional campaign kick-off in November.
Gov. Peter Shumlin, a Democrat, said in June that he wouldn't be seeking a third two-year term.
Since then, Republican businessman Bruce Lisman and two Democrats — House Speaker Shap Smith and former lawmaker Matt Dunne — have announced their campaigns.
